Mobifusion To Deliver Britannica Concise Encyclopaedia Exclusively on Hutch Phones — Hutch customers can now access one of the world’s most trusted information sources on their phones —

July 11, 2007 (PRLEAP.COM) Business News
Mumbai and Fremont, CA, July 11, 2007 – Hutch, one of India’s leading telecom service providers, along with Mobifusion, a U.S.-based pioneer in the world of mobile media, introduced a new mobile product from the editors of Encyclopaedia Britannica, Britannica Concise Encyclopedia. The Britannica Concise Encyclopedia will be available for the first time in India exclusively to Hutch subscribers. The service features an easy-to-use tool to research history, art, entertainment, politics, sports and a host of other topics all from the Hutch phone.

With this service, Hutch aims to provide greater convenience to its subscribers with relevant mobile content. The Britannica Concise Encyclopedia is a huge reservoir of knowledge and one of the world’s most trusted reference works, and its concise edition is an excellent source of overviews and quick facts on more than 25,000 topics. About Hutchison Essar Limited
Hutchison Essar established its presence in India in 1994 by acquiring the cellular license for Mumbai. It now has operations in 16 circles accounting for 70% of India’s mobile customer base. With over 29.2 million customers, it is one of India’s most reputed telecom companies.

Hutchison Essar, under the Hutch brand, over the years, has been named the ‘Most Respected Telecom Company’, the ‘Best Mobile Service in the country’, and the ‘Most Creative and Most Effective Advertiser of the Year’.

Hutchison Essar is now part of Vodafone - the world’s leading international mobile communications company. Vodafone now has operations in 26 countries across 5 continents and 36 partner networks with about 225 million proportionate customers worldwide. Vodafone has tied up with Essar as its principal joint venture partner for the Indian operation.

About Encyclopaedia Britannica
Encyclopaedia Britannica, Inc. (www.britannica.com) is a leader in reference and education publishing whose products can be found in many media, from the Internet to cell phones to books. A pioneer in electronic publishing since the early 1980s, the company still publishes the 32-volume Encyclopaedia Britannica, along with services such as Britannica Online School Edition and new printed products such as Britannica Student Encyclopedia, available for purchase at Britannica’s online store (store.britannica.com). Britannica’s editorial operation is overseen by some of the world’s most distinguished scholars. The company makes its headquarters in Chicago.
